Bang—!

    The door slammed shut.

    Calix stood in front of the closed door and smiled blandly.

    The youth only opened the door a small crack to snatch the clothes before closing it again as if to say he had no other business here.

    He purposely sent the tailor in with the clothes, but it seemed that such tricks wouldn’t succeed so easily. Because he had played by his side all evening, Calix had hoped that the youth might just let him in, but it was plain to see that it was only false hope.

    He could sense the blatant shock from the guards behind him.

    Since they had just seen their lord receive such a rejection, it seemed fitting. They were at a loss, not knowing if they should break down the door immediately and drag the youth out or if they should act as if they hadn’t seen anything.

    Calix stared at the tightly closed door and waited silently. If he guessed right, the youth would definitely open this door again and let him in.

    How much time had passed?

    The door furtively opened, and the youth’s head peeked out from the crack. His gaze landed on Calix, who was still rooted to the same spot as before, and he narrowed his eyes.

    “Kay.”

    Calix’s expression brightened as he called the youth’s name, but the other’s narrowed eyes were brimming with doubt and suspicion. For a brief moment, the youth continued to stare at him with a fierce gaze, but then he opened the door a bit wider and nodded his head as if to tell him to enter. Calix strode through the open door before the youth could change his mind.

    The room’s interior looked exactly as he had expected.

    The clothes he had snatched through the door were strewn all over the bed. Calix could easily tell that he had rushed to try them on.
